Lecturer vacancies at King’s College London
As part of a significant investment and expanding programme in existing and emergent research areas and student numbers across its MA and BA curricula in digital culture, King’s College London is recruiting five (Senior) Lecturers in the Department of Digital Humanities, with expertise ranging from digital methods and global digital cultures, to games and virtual environments. King’s College London has a long tradition of research in the digital humanities, going back to the early 1990s. For a full description of the current vacancies, visit the recruitment website. The closing date for applications is 28 April 2019.
